## Changelog — BranchSweep v2.4.1

Rotated the deploy credentials for BranchSweep, our stale-branch cleanup bot, as part of the quarterly rotation at Lintfern Labs. The old key was revoked this morning; any pipelines still referencing it will fail with an auth error until updated. If you're a new contractor setting up the bot locally, pull the latest config from the ops repo first. No behavior changes otherwise — pruning thresholds and the 90-day cutoff remain the same. The current deploy key is below.

rollout seal: bky9_PeXH1fTLY

Subject: Cold storage archive cut-over — done

Team, the Glacierbox migration wrapped last night. All cold buckets on Harkness tier-3 are now archived, lifecycle rules flipped, and reads verified on a sample set. Nothing dropped, billing should drop next cycle. One hiccup with manifest ordering, now fixed. The archiver ran with these settings.

settings of yaguf-fajof:
[druvan]
host = druvan.plorvatech.example
user = druvan_svc
database = druvan_prod

## Build Provenance — Coldpath Handlers

Cold starts on the Murkfield serverless tier are provenance-sensitive: the init snapshot is baked at build time, so any unverified layer inflates startup by ~800ms. Always rebuild handlers from the pinned base image; never patch layers in place. Provenance attestations live alongside each artifact in the Coldpath store. When auditing a slow cold start, match the deployed snapshot against the token that follows.

build token for yaweg-fawig: htk4_45ef